Transaction

db7a50f64623dbcaaff29f0ab651779ef5edae97559e898be9199e3a1375fa49

Summary

In Block882388
TimeMon, 23 Sep 2024 12:14:00 UTC
Total Input2478.08584349 Nebula
Total Output2478.08577989 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
91581 Confirmations2478.08577989 Nebula
Raw Transaction